diff options
author | Oliver-Rainer Wittmann <orw@apache.org> | 2014-05-19 11:50:38 +0000 |
---|---|---|
committer | Oliver-Rainer Wittmann <orw@apache.org> | 2014-05-19 11:50:38 +0000 |
commit | a5cfb91f3dc4b38055fb920f65101cc45d52f8de (patch) | |
tree | 66a6ada20d1e3910b10990db76353daf55b6e8ed /svtools | |
parent | a90c007908eb3f66e28a9ea525729065db652b6f (diff) |
124717: do not mark *.svm graphic files as *.bmp graphic files
Notes
Notes:
merged as: 12dd68e3d20ad36ebe7cb40a600215f6d2b7b6ec
Diffstat (limited to 'svtools')
-rw-r--r-- | svtools/source/filter/filter.cxx | 11 |
1 files changed, 7 insertions, 4 deletions
diff --git a/svtools/source/filter/filter.cxx b/svtools/source/filter/filter.cxx index 7b474884d1e2..71f3f90f29e7 100644 --- a/svtools/source/filter/filter.cxx +++ b/svtools/source/filter/filter.cxx @@ -1630,8 +1630,8 @@ sal_uInt16 GraphicFilter::ImportGraphic( Graphic& rGraphic, const String& rPath, if( !ImportXPM( rIStream, rGraphic ) ) nStatus = GRFILTER_FILTERERROR; } - else if( aFilterName.EqualsIgnoreCaseAscii( IMP_BMP ) || - aFilterName.EqualsIgnoreCaseAscii( IMP_SVMETAFILE ) ) + else if ( aFilterName.EqualsIgnoreCaseAscii( IMP_BMP ) + || aFilterName.EqualsIgnoreCaseAscii( IMP_SVMETAFILE ) ) { // SV interne Importfilter fuer Bitmaps und MetaFiles rIStream >> rGraphic; @@ -1642,8 +1642,11 @@ sal_uInt16 GraphicFilter::ImportGraphic( Graphic& rGraphic, const String& rPath, } else { - // #15508# added BMP type (checked, works) - eLinkType = GFX_LINK_TYPE_NATIVE_BMP; + if ( aFilterName.EqualsIgnoreCaseAscii( IMP_BMP ) ) + { + // #15508# added BMP type (checked, works) + eLinkType = GFX_LINK_TYPE_NATIVE_BMP; + } } } else if( aFilterName.EqualsIgnoreCaseAscii( IMP_WMF ) || |